Prokatchers is Hiring a Behavioral Health Associate Near The Bronx, NY

Position: Behavioral Health Associate

Duration: 3 months contract (Possible extension)

Location: Bronx , NY

Shift Timings: 7:00 AM - 3:00 PM

Shift Timings: 3:00 PM - 11:30 PM

Shift Timings: 11:00 PM - 7:00 AM

Job Description:

  • Immediately reports extreme and dangerous changes in client’s condition and/or behavior to medical personnel; immediately reports hazardous conditions which can endanger the well- being of clients, visitors, and hospital staff to the appropriate personnel.
  • Safely escorts patient’s to and from internal and external destinations as appropriate and required; assists clinical personnel in transferring patient’s to and from assigned departments as required.
  • Advises and addresses the treatment team of issues or situations that require follow-up care and/or immediate or additional attention, informing the ADN, Head Nurse of such situations.
  • Assist patient with ADLs (i.e shaving) as needed and when directed by clinical staff.
  • Performs CPR as needed.
  • Identifies patient characteristics and environmental variables that may trigger agitated behaviors, violence, and communicates this information to the treatment team.
  • Demonstrates competency in dealing with potentially violent patients. Effectively utilizes crisis intervention/de-escalation practices and non-physical behavioral management techniques, when necessary and appropriate, with patients whose behavior cannot be otherwise supported without such interventions.
  • Demonstrates competency and assists in the application and removal of restraints and the implementation of seclusion when deemed necessary by appropriate personnel; demonstrates awareness of the possibility of physical and/or emotional injury to the patient during the application and utilization of restraints and/or the implementation of seclusion and ensures the physical and emotional health and safety of the patient when using such methods.
  • Adheres to all relevant corporate, hospital, and regulatory policies and procedures regarding patient safety. Performs patient checks and rounds as required or when the treatment team designates the need for more frequent rounding due to unit activity.
  • Creates an empathetic and welcoming environment, routinely providing encouragement and support, acts as a liaison among the client, family, and medical personnel.
  • First responder to Code Grey calls; ensures appropriate care of the patient and assists staff in de-escalation techniques.
  • Detects and reports presence of unauthorized personnel, contraband, and/or activities; responds appropriately to incidents according to departmental procedures.
  • Monitors patients, family, visitor, and staff traffic flow.
  • Reports other offensive conduct. Inspects and categorizes patient’s belongings at time of admission and assures that property is safely maintained and returned to patient at the time of transfer or discharge.
  • Immediately reports individuals who appear to be disoriented, confused, or unaware of their surroundings to ensure their protection; remains with or watches them until appropriate personnel arrive.
  • Participate in unit safety and environmental rounds, as assigned.
  • Demonstrates effective verbal and written communication skills. Participates in ongoing education and training designed to encourage non-confrontational patient care methods.
  • Performs other related duties as assigned.
